  • Re: Beovision Avant screen lines

    There is many info on this topic on this forum. If you don't know anything about tv technology than don't try it yourself but in short i'd advice you to establish if it is really the tube (which indeed is actally always the case) and than try to ''clean'' it with glowing and tapping, which doesn't cost more than time

  • Re: avant picture problem - any advice, please...

    If the lines are white: most likely something with a louzy G2 control or HT/flyback electronics problem If the lines are either blue, red or green: most likely the tube (easy to find out by a tech).
